NAHL 2018-19 Award Winners

2018-19 All-NAHL 1st Team

  • Forward: Logan Jenuwine, Amarillo Bulls
  • Forward: Carson Briere, Johnstown Tomahawks
  • Forward: Brad Belisle, Aberdeen Wings
  • Defense: Brenden Datema, Amarillo Bulls
  • Defense: CJ McGee, Shreveport Mudbugs
  • Goalie: Matt Vernon, Aberdeen Wings

2018-19 All-NAHL 2nd Team

  • Forward: Samuel Solensky, Johnstown Tomahawks
  • Forward: Brandon Puricelli, Springfield Jr. Blues
  • Forward: Dante Sheriff, Austin Bruins
  • Defense: Sam Malinski, Bismarck Bobcats
  • Defense: Blake Evennou, Lone Star Brahmas
  • Goalie: Zach Stejskal, Wilkes-Barre/Scranton Knights

2018-19 NAHL Individual Awards

2018-19 Most Valuable Player and Forward of the Year

Logan Jenuwine, Amarillo Bulls

2018-19 Vaughn Goaltender of the Year

Matt Vernon, Aberdeen Wings

2018-19 Defenseman of the Year

Brenden Datema, Amarillo Bulls

2018-19 Rookie of the Year

Jonathan Sorenson, Fairbanks Ice Dogs

2018-19 Coach of the Year

Mike Letizia, Johnstown Tomahawks

2018-19 General Manager of the Year

Marty Murray, Minot Minotauros

2018-19 Executive of the Year

Rick Bouchard, Johnstown Tomahawks

2018-19 Organization of the Year

Johnstown Tomahawks

2018-19 Apex Learning Virtual School Academic Achievement Award

Konner Lundeen, Minnesota Magicians

2018-19 Leadership Award

John Roberts, Bismarck Bobcats

2018-19 Community Service Award

Brandon Perrone, New Jersey Titans
